wordpress 页面固定(wordpress固定链接设置)

随着互联网技术的飞速发展,网站建设已经成为了每个人都需要掌握的一项基本技能。WordPress作为一个强大的内容管理系统,其易用性和丰富的插件生态让很多人选择了它来搭建自己的网站。而在这个基础上,很多人可能会遇到这样的问题:如何让自己的WordPress页面在用户浏览时固定不动,从而提供更好的用户体验?今天,我就来和大家聊聊WordPress页面固定的那些事儿。

一、为什么要固定WordPress页面?

1. 提升用户体验:固定页面可以方便用户快速访问常用功能,如导航菜单、搜索框等,提高网站的实用性。

2. 优化视觉效果:固定页面可以增强网站的美观度,让用户在浏览时感到更加舒适。

3. 强调重要信息:通过固定页面,可以突出显示关键信息,吸引用户关注。

二、如何固定WordPress页面?

固定WordPress页面的方法有很多种,以下列举几种常见的实现方式:

1. 使用固定插件

(1)固定导航菜单插件

这类插件可以实现固定顶部导航菜单的效果。以下是几种常见的固定导航菜单插件:

插件名称 介绍
StickyMenu 适用于所有类型的菜单,支持自定义样式。
SmartMenu 支持响应式设计,适合移动端和桌面端。
SuperStickyMenu 功能强大,支持多种菜单固定效果。

(2)固定搜索框插件

这类插件可以实现在页面固定位置显示搜索框,方便用户随时进行搜索。以下是几种常见的固定搜索框插件:

插件名称 介绍
WPStickySearch 支持自定义样式,方便调整搜索框位置。
WPSearchBar 功能强大,支持自定义搜索框样式。
FixedWidgetSearchBox 适用于固定侧边栏搜索框的插件。

2. CSS代码实现

除了使用插件外,我们还可以通过CSS代码来固定页面。以下是一个简单的示例:

“`css

sticky-menu {

position: fixed;

top: 0;

left: 0;

width: 100%;

background-color: fff;

z-index: 1000;

}

search-box {

position: fixed;

top: 50px;

right: 20px;

z-index: 1000;

}

“`

在这个例子中,我们通过将导航菜单和搜索框设置为固定位置,实现了固定页面的效果。

3. 自定义主题

如果想要更精细地控制固定页面,可以通过自定义主题来实现。在主题的CSS文件中添加相应的样式即可。

三、固定WordPress页面时的注意事项

1. 优化加载速度:使用固定页面时,要确保页面加载速度不会受到影响。

2. 适配不同设备:固定页面要适应不同的设备和屏幕尺寸。

3. 注意布局美观:固定页面后,要保证整个网站的布局依然美观。

总结

固定WordPress页面是一个提升用户体验和视觉效果的好方法。通过使用插件、CSS代码或自定义主题,我们可以轻松实现这一效果。在实际操作过程中,我们要注意优化加载速度、适配不同设备以及保持布局美观。希望这篇文章能帮助大家更好地掌握固定WordPress页面的技巧。

wordpress更改过页面固定连接以后为什么新建页面出现404错误

在 WordPress后台设置了自定义固定链接后,前台页面无法显示,提示 404错误

页面,但是原来默认的动态路径还是可以打开,这是为什么?站长分析:一般我们使用开源程序,如 WORDPRESS

这类程序时,都会先在本地调试,并上传些数据,如题所述的问题,在本站调试的时候就出现过,查阅了些资料,得出的结论,最大的可能性就是

apache(PHP服务器)的配置出现了问题。在后台设置了自定义的固定链接后,相当于是自定义了站点的伪静态规则,那么

在调试的过程中,你的服务器环境就必须支持伪静态才可以打开静态的路径,一般能进后台配置固定路径,那么你的服务器环境大致是没有什么问题的,动态路

径也可以打开,说明数据库连接及权限等问题都不大会存在问题,问题一般就出在你没有开启 Apache支持伪静态的功能,如何实现呢?

前提条件:你用的是 Apache服务器先找到 Apache安装的路径,在其根目录下“conf文件夹”中有一个文件叫

“httpd.conf”,用记事本将它打开,按“ctrl+F”键,弹出查找窗口,输入“#LoadModule rewrite_module

modules/mod_rewrite.so”,如果能找到的话,把前面的#删除,这个#号表示注释,也就是没有开启,我们去掉之后也就开启了

“mod_rewrite”这一模块,如果找不到,再尝试输入“LoadModule rewrite_module

modules/mod_rewrite.so”,看能否找到,如果能找到,说明这个模块已经开启,继续查找“ Options FollowSymLinks AllowOverride None Order deny,allow Deny from all

”将其中的“AllowOverride None”改为“AllowOverride all”,为保险起见,

你也可以再查找一下“AllowOverride None”,可能会出现多处,全部替换成“AllowOverride all”,然后保存文件。

接下来,重启 apache服务器,再去后台保存一下“固定链接”,重新打开页面,看是否能够打开了。

如果还是打不开,您可以通过本站的联系方式联系站长帮你看看!

如果你不是 Apache服务器,而是用的 IIS调试的话,那就得去安装一个“ISAPI_Rewrite3_0069_Lite.msi”筛选器,然后在站点设置里面将 PHP置为优先级。

wordpress 自定义页面 怎么实现的

WordPress自定义页面(以本站的综合资讯类博客页面为例):

1、通过FTP登录我们的主机,下载所用主题文件夹内的page.php文件;

2、把page.php文件重命名为page-zhzx.php,其中zhzx就是综合资讯类博客页面固定链接后面的那个,这个文件名字一定要跟我们新增页面的固定链接相一致;

3、直接编辑page-zhzx.php变成我们需要的页面,直接把<?php the_content();?>修改为<?php wp_list_bookmarks('title_li=&categorize=0&orderby=rand&category=5');?>,其中category=5中的5就是综合资讯分类的ID。

4、把编辑好的page-zhzx.php文件回传到我们所用的主题文件夹内进行更新覆盖;

5、登录WordPress后台添加综合资讯类博客页面,其他导航分类页面操作都一样,关键就是要修改固定链接的后缀,跟page-后面的一一对应即可。

写出来就是很多,其实做起来就很简单的,说明就是新建一个页面,修改固定链接,然后把页面的固定链接后面那部分(如zhzx)复制,然后重命名一个page.php文件为page-zhzx.php即可。

具体可以参考本站分享的《如何建立WordPress自定义页面》这篇文章。

如何自定义WordPress文章,页面,标签和分类的固定链接

1.有自定义文章类型,希望自定义文章类型和默认的Post都在首页的主循环中显示。

2.有自定义文章类型(产品),首页主循环中只显示产品。

注意,本教程中只对应首页的主循环,即不适用首页一些侧边栏、或者自定义的文章查询区域。

将下面代码添加到主题的functions.php中即可

function ashuwp_posts_per_page($query){

//首页或者搜索页的主循环

if((is_home()|| is_search())&&$query->is_main_query())

//$query->set(‘post_type’, array(‘product’));//只显示product

$query->set(‘post_type’, array(‘post’,‘product’));//主循环中显示post和product

return$query;

}

add_action(‘pre_get_posts’,’ashuwp_posts_per_page’);

利用pre_get_posts钩子,不光可以实现本教程所需要的内容,还可自由发挥,改变主循环的其它一些参数。

比如仅仅想让首页的文章数量显示为5篇。

function ashuwp_posts_per_page($query){

//仅首页

if( is_home())

$query->set(‘posts_per_page’,5);//每页显示5篇

return$query;

}

add_action(‘pre_get_posts’,’ashuwp_posts_per_page’);

© 版权声明
THE END
喜欢就支持一下吧
点赞14 分享